The Bare Necessities

To create your solar-powered Kool-Aid lights, you'll need:

  • Empty plastic container (thoroughly washed)
  • 1.5V mini solar panel
  • LED strip (warm white works best)
  • Rechargeable AA battery
  • Hot glue gun

When Rain Meets Innovation

For rainy climates like Seattle, drill drainage holes at the base. Use silicone sealant around the solar panel edges – this simple fix increased waterproofing efficiency by 63% in our tests. Pro tip: Angle the container slightly downward to prevent water pooling.

Q&A: Your Burning Questions

Q: Can I use other drink containers?
A: Absolutely! Gatorade bottles work well too, though their thicker plastic requires sharper cutting tools.

Q: How long do these lights typically last?
A: With proper care, the solar components function for 2-3 years. The plastic container itself? Practically forever.

Q: Is this safe around children/pets?
A: When sealed properly, yes. Use low-voltage LEDs (under 12V) and ensure all wiring is insulated.
